Transaction 62161786a95d7f44f06c5a36b67ff1453faa27b412fbdf3e581f1c4d4cd68d03

1 Input
2 Outputs
  • 62161786a95d7f44f06c5a36b67ff1453faa27b412fbdf3e581f1c4d4cd68d03:0
  • value  66313260
    address  16YtSyhRfXkx59171rkfvETAWzFGTTcQMU
  • 62161786a95d7f44f06c5a36b67ff1453faa27b412fbdf3e581f1c4d4cd68d03:1
  • value  348454
    address  39XpL1Nehtnd4AT5AyTuGgFm9ZSNYMMS1p